If looking for a mid-budget relic-hunting tool, Wedigout underwater metal detector is the one to go with. Its Pulse Induction mechanism takes operating the device from the just-for-fun level to the closely-focused-on-finding-gold level.
The construction of the detector is envious – it features stainless steel hardware and the low battery sensor designed to last many years.
The built-in microprocessor provides you with stable depth detection, which means that you won’t run out of battery before you locate the artifact that was buried deep under the water.
The automatic turning promotes even easier hunting that doesn’t involve any additional adjustments. When the target is detected, Wedigout will vibrate and flash with a bright light more the closer you get to the target. Then, once you decide it’s time to dig, you’ll be able to quickly turn it off and pursue your treasure with the utmost attention.
